Electoral Commission admits software glitch led to referendum voting cards being sent to EU citizens in the UK

clock • 3 min read

EU citizens arriving at polling stations with erroneously sent cards will be sent away, claims Electoral Commission

The Electoral Commission has blamed a software 'glitch' for sending out voting cards in the UK's upcoming EU referendum to non-British citizens who are not eligible to vote. In a statement relea...
